Product Details of [ 691876-16-1 ]

CAS No. :691876-16-1
Formula : C13H23NO4
M.W : 257.33
SMILES Code : O=C(N1CC(CC(OC)=O)CCC1)OC(C)(C)C
MDL No. :MFCD02179004

YieldReaction ConditionsOperation in experiment
80% A suspension of ethyl-3-pyridylacetate (5.0 g, 30 RNMOL) and platinum oxide (500 mg), in acidic ethanol (200 ML of 1% HCl/EtOH) was placed on a parr shaker and treated with hydrogen at 50 psi for 15 hours. The reaction was then flushed with nitrogen, the catalyst filtered off (plug of Celite), and the solvent evaporated under reduced pressure to yield 5.86 g (100%) of a white solid. The material was then dissolved in dichloromethane (200 ml) and treated with diisopropyl ethylamine (5. 25 ml, 30.26 mmol) and di-tert-butyl-dicarbonate (7.00 g, 31.77 mmol). The resulting mixture was stirred at room temperature overnight. The solution was washed with IN HCI (100 ml), saturated sodium bicarbonate (100 ml), brine (100 ml), dried over anhydrous sodium sulfate, and the solvent evaporated at reduced pressure to yield 7.5 g (97%) of the crude product as a yellow oil. Purification was done by MPLC (eluant: 10% ethyl acetate/hexane) to give 6.22 g (80%) of the pure desired product.
